Monument record TR 04 NW 53 - Site of lime kiln and quarry, Soakham Farm, Boughton Aluph
Summary
A diused quarry is located at Soakham Farm in Boughton Aluph. Within the pits are two limekilns that were believed to have been in operation around 1877. These features are marked on the Ordnance Survey historic maps within the chalk pits. The pits remain today and are thought to contain farm buildings.
